How many species can you use in a full multi-species coalescent tree inference such as BPP or Star-Beast ?
Also, does it work well for old divergences (like hundreds of millions of years)?

In Xu & Yang 2016, they say:

> Furthermore, current Bayesian implementations do not deal with the violation of the molecular clock adequately and do not appear to work very well for deep species phylogenies (Ogilvie et al. 2016)

But since then, has it improved?

New #openaccess paper & method in @SystBiol: https://doi.org/10.1093/sysbio/syad018

We introduce and implement a newly developed approach to reconstruct potential past distributions for ancestral lineages across North American #Heuchereae and across a paleoclimatic record extending from the late #Pliocene. We employ an improved framework with a #coalescent simulation approach to test and confirm previous hybridization hypotheses and identify one new intergeneric #hybridization event

Our PhyloCoalSimulations.jl :julia:package simulates gene genealogies under an extended #coalescent model with #hybridization and gene flow.

I hope it will stimulate more simulation-based studies!

The #network is given in Newick format, and gene trees can be mapped inside the species (or population) network.
